Reference Value Report: Living Wage Report and 2025 Update for Rural Panama
This report updates the Anker Living Wage Reference Value for rural Panama for the year 2025. The updated Anker Gross Living Wage for 2025 is USD 615 per month, which is composed of a Net Living Wage of USD 547, plus a contribution to social security and educational insurance of USD 68. In the original Reference Value report, the Gross Living Wage for 2020 was USD 569, consisting of a Net Living Wage of USD 513 plus a social security contribution of USD 56. In this report, we use the most recent inflation data to update the living wage: From June 2020 to June 2025 cumulative inflation was 6.7%. It is important to mention that between June 2024 and June 2025 the general price level in Panama experienced a slight deflationary trend, with an annual inflation rate of -0.44%. Social security contributions and income tax were calculated based on tax laws in force as of June 2025.

Original Report
2020 Reference Value Report: Living Wage Report for Rural Panama
Abstract
The Anker Living Wage Reference Value for 2020 for rural Panama is USD 569, including tax, per month with a 95% confidence interval around it from USD 505 to USD 640. This is the wage required for workers to be able to afford a basic but decent living standard in a typical rural area of Panama. The Reference Value is comprised of a net living wage (i.e. take-home pay) of USD 513 per month plus USD 56 per month which would be deducted by law from pay per month for social security. Workers earning a living wage would not have to pay income tax, since workers who earn an annual amount of USD 11,000 or less are not required to pay personal income tax.
